Industry offers alternative to simplified securitisation capital formula

The Basel approach is criticised as inconsistent, prompting a group of quants to develop an alternative

choices11

A group of quants has developed an alternative to the Basel Committee on Banking Supervision's proposed simplified supervisory formula approach (SSFA) for securitised assets in the banking book, in an attempt to make it more consistent with the advanced method.
